I will need to add a separate “weight” slider for roll (lateral) than pitch (longitudinal) because the roll actuators are much more responsive. I also need to figure up a minimum “overvoltage” to break static friction and get the platform moving on command. The aggression should probably be divided by 10 so that we can select a more fine tuned value.
On another note, testing these old Planar Toshiba LTM10C942 (640×480 10″) LCD monitors that run at 75Hz with the AV-620 works great (they don’t advertise the 640×480 because the Windows 7 UI doesn’t show it as an option but if you drill into Advanced Settings -> List All Modes you will see it in there.
